What is a Paper Ream?
A paper ream generally consists of 500 sheets of paper. This standardized amount has remained in usage because the 15th century and helps streamline the getting procedure, whether for personal or service usage. The ream works as a consistent unit of step for buying paper, which comes in various sizes, weights, and surfaces.

The Evolution of the Ream
The idea of the ream dates back to the time of handcrafted paper, when it prevailed to bundle sheets for ease of transportation and sale. At first, reams could include different quantities of sheets, including 480 or perhaps 600 sheets, depending on the area. Nevertheless, the 500-sheet standard ended up being commonly accepted due to its practicality and the growing demand for consistency in the printing and publishing markets.
Kinds Of Paper Reams
Not all paper reams are produced equal. Here are some common kinds of paper reams based upon their properties:
Multipurpose Copy Paper Paper Reams: Standardized for daily printing and copying. Usually 20 lb or 24 pound in weight, it is created for high-capacity printers.
Cardstock Reams: Thicker and much heavier than standard copy paper, cardstock is frequently utilized for company cards, invites, and other durable print products.
Image Paper Reams: Designed for printing premium images, image paper is available in numerous surfaces such as glossy, matte, or satin.
Specialty Paper Reams: This category includes documents designed for particular purposes, such as resume paper, legal paper, or colored paper.

Frequently Asked Questions About Paper Reams
1. How much does a ream of paper weigh?
A standard ream of 500 sheets of 20 lb paper weighs approximately 5 pounds. Much heavier types of paper will increase this weight accordingly.
2. How many reams remain in a case of paper?
Generally, a case of paper will contain 10 reams, totaling up to a total of 5,000 sheets.
3. Can I buy partial reams of paper?
Yes, lots of workplace supply stores and online sellers use single reams or perhaps smaller sized quantities. This is specifically useful for those who do not require a complete case.
4. How should I save paper reams?
It's best to store paper in a cool, dry location to prevent wetness absorption. Keeping it flat and away from direct sunshine will likewise help keep its quality.
5. What is the distinction between bond paper and copy paper?
Bond paper is typically thicker and more long lasting than basic copy paper. It's typically used for legal documents or official correspondence while copy paper is developed for daily printing.
